This is the perfect trip if you want to see the Andes without too much physical effort. It is a half day trip, mostly a road trip with a couple of short walking to great lookouts. We are going to plant a native tree in Patagonia for each member of the group while you are hiking in order to compensate the co2 generated.
We pick up all our travelers from their hotel locations in Santiago (Santiago Centro, Vitacura, Las Condes, Lo Barnechea, Providencia) Also we pick up at airport with an extra charge of 30 USD per person.
We are going to stop in a nice lookout where we will provide you binoculars to see some scenic peaks inside Yerba Loca Park, like, La Paloma Glacier. Also Condor encounters are common here.
Visit to Valle Nevado Ski Resort located at more than 3000 meters with great views of the Andes Range including Plomo mount covered by glaciers
We will walk to a "secret" spot where you will have an amazing view of the mountain while you enjoy a table of chilean cheese and wine. Condor and Fox encounters are usual as well other native fauna.
